The seven gentlemen gathered Saturday afternoon to compete in the first annual pipe smoking competition hosted by El Humidor Smoke Shop, Scott Street, Wilkes-Barre.

Wesley, a newcomer to the group, took up pipe smoking around eight months ago and has been practicing consistently over the past week in order to prepare for the competition.

"I own my own shop so I can smoke all day," laughed Wesley, adding that he went as far as having his employees record his times.

The purpose of a pipe smoking competition is simple. The competitor who can make their pipe burn the longest wins. To begin, the contestants were read a short but strict list of rules which was consistent with the United Pipe Clubs of America's (UPCA) standards.
